About This Item

Munchen: Selbstverlag/Suddeutschen Verlag, 1952. Octavo, 478 pages. First edition. Walterspiel was a prominent German chef, restaurateur and hotelier. After operating a string of other restaurants and hotels throughout northern Europe, Alfred, with his brother Otto, opened purchased the Hotel Four Seasons in Munich, and opened the Restaurant Walterspiel. The restaurant was open throughout World War II, but was bombed and burnt to the ground in 1944. They reopened the hotel in 1950, and Alfred issued this combined memoir/cookbook. This copy is inscribed to the great Swiss hotelier Ferdinand Sperl, and additional carries a gift inscription from Sperl's wife. With the bookplate of Sperl to the front paste-down, and a review of the book by Harry Schraemli pasted to the front fly. Lacking the original dust jacket, one small adhesion mark to front paste-down, otherwise fine.
